# Tollgate Consent Banner — Environments

The Tollgate consent banner rolls out across three environments: sandbox, preview, and production. Sandbox disables consent persistence entirely; preview stores choices in Varnholt-region storage only; production enforces regional residency. Reviewers should confirm that logging excludes pre-consent identifiers. Each environment's enforced configuration appears below.

config for hawep-taweg:
[frair]
port = 8443
region = west-3
host = frair.sivrelhq.internal
team = oliael
timeout_ms = 1000
retries = 2

**Q: Customers report slow reports after the Granby 4.2 upgrade — is this the query planner regression?**

A: Likely yes. The 4.2 planner on Wexfold clusters sometimes picks a sequential scan over the composite index when stats are stale. Workaround: have the customer run the stats refresh job, then retest; a patched planner ships in 4.2.3. If you need the diagnostics bundle from the sealed support vault to confirm plan shapes, unlock it with the recovery passphrase below.

vault phrase of yagag-yafof = belael-weniel-kasion-silath-jorax-pelox-silir-soreth-ralmir

**Memo — Revised Sales Commission Scheme**

To: Heads of Department

Effective next quarter, commissions on the Lumetra range move to a tiered model: higher rates on renewals, reduced rates on discounted new business. Draw arrangements are unchanged. Department heads should brief their teams by the 20th; payroll adjustments follow automatically. The underlying business rationale is set out below.

board note of baweg-bawig: Project Tamath slips by six weeks because of the audit delay.